Why pulsed water

Control, not force.

A constant stream gives you one setting: more pressure, or less water. Pulsing breaks the flow into short bursts, so a soft setting still feels like it is doing something.

Soft mode: long, low-pressure pulses through the wide nozzle. Built for the first weeks after birth, stitches and flare-ups.

Everything you'd want to ask.

What makes a pulse bidet different from a normal portable one?

A normal portable bidet squeezes or pumps a continuous stream, so the only variable is pressure. Bemour Flow breaks the flow into pulses. A soft pulse still registers as effective, which means you can wash at a pressure that would feel like nothing on a constant-stream device.

Which mode should I use after giving birth?

Soft, with the wide nozzle, and warm water from the tap. Start further away than feels necessary and move in. If you have stitches, a tear or a c-section wound, check with your midwife or doctor before you start using anything new. We are not a medical device and we will not pretend otherwise.

How long does a charge last?

We have specified around 30 days of typical use per USB-C charge with the factory. That figure is still a target until we measure production units, which is why it is flagged on the spec sheet.

Is it discreet in a bag?

It folds down and goes into a plain pouch with no product name on it. Nothing about the outside says what it is.
